Understanding Buena Park's Zip Code Zones

Buena Park, California, is strategically divided into several zip code areas, each serving distinct geographical sections of the city. The most prominent zip code, 90620, generally covers the central and southern parts of Buena Park. This area is densely populated and home to many well-known landmarks and commercial centers.

The 90621 Zone: East Buena Park

The 90621 zip code primarily serves the eastern portion of Buena Park. This area often features a mix of residential neighborhoods, local parks, and smaller business districts. Residents in 90621 benefit from community amenities and a suburban feel characteristic of many Southern California cities.

Exploring 90622: North and West Buena Park

Zip code 90622 typically encompasses the northern and western sections of Buena Park. This zone includes residential areas, schools, and community facilities. Understanding the boundaries of 90622 is key for navigating local services and community events efficiently.

The 90623 Area: Southern Reach

Finally, 90623 often designates areas further south within Buena Park's broader reach, sometimes bordering neighboring cities. This zip code can include residential zones and commercial developments that extend towards the southern edge of the city limits.

Key Landmarks and Areas by Zip Code

Buena Park is renowned for its entertainment options and family-friendly atmosphere. Certain zip codes are more closely associated with specific attractions. While zip code boundaries aren't always exact matches for tourist maps, this gives you a general idea.

Knott's Berry Farm and Vicinity (Primarily 90620)

No discussion of Buena Park is complete without mentioning Knott's Berry Farm. The theme park and its immediate surroundings largely fall within the 90620 zip code. This area is a hub of activity, attracting visitors year-round. The surrounding commercial zones also utilize 90620 for their operations.

How do I find the zip code for a specific address in Buena Park?

You can use the official USPS website or other online zip code lookup tools. Enter the full street address, and the tool will provide the correct zip code.

Does the zip code affect property taxes or school districts?

While zip codes are a general geographic indicator, property taxes and school district assignments are typically determined by more precise city and county boundaries, not solely by zip code. However, zip codes can provide a good initial reference point for these areas.

Can a single street have multiple zip codes?

It's highly uncommon for a single street address to have multiple zip codes. Zip codes are designed to be specific enough for efficient mail sorting. However, very long streets that span different neighborhoods or cross city boundaries might have different zip codes for different segments.
